Frere Hospital is a tertiary hospital in Buffalo City Metropolitan Municipality, Eastern Cape, South Africa. As a tertiary hospital, it provides highly specialised care and receives referrals from regional and district hospitals across the region. Located in Buffalo City Sub-District, Buffalo City Metropolitan Municipality, it forms part of the Eastern Cape Department of Health's public healthcare network. It is an accredited medical internship training site for junior doctors in Eastern Cape. Accredited postgraduate training includes Anaesthesiology - DA(SA), Paediatrics - DCH(SA), Primary Emergency Care - Dip PEC(SA).
Has an emergency / casualty department
